UPVC Window Handle Replacement

Replacing a damaged or broken window handle is a relatively easy process, and, with the right tools, it can be accomplished quite quickly. It is important to identify the kind of handle you have and its spindle size before you purchase the replacement windows prices.

doorpanels-300x200.jpg?Older uPVC window handles have a spur which protrudes and locks on the wedge striker. They can be left- or right-handed and must be compatible when replaced.

What kind of lock and handle do I have?

There are a variety of window locks and handles made from upvc each with their own advantages and purposes. The type of handle you are using will determine how easy it is to open your windows and whether or not the locking mechanism functions in the way you want it to. Over time and through regular usage, the window handles made of upvc can become damaged or worn out, rendering them less secure and efficient. In some instances, they may even fall off completely. It is important to repair your upvc window handles immediately if you notice them falling off. This will help to stop potential burglaries and protect your home from burglary.

It is a good thing that replacing your window handles made of plastic is a relatively simple task that is achievable by anyone. You'll require a few tools, but with right knowledge, it is an easy task that will take only a couple of minutes. To get started you'll need to identify the type of lock and handle you have on your window made of upvc, which will help you find the perfect replacement of window glass.

Inline Espagnolette Handles

They are typically located on the outside of the window. They are flat and come with a latch which engages the locking mechanism of the window frame. Inline upvc handles have a spindle that runs through the middle of the handle to the window frame to operate the latch.

Cockspur Handles

These handles are typically located on older uPVC windows and feature distinct hook-shaped designs. Cockspur handles are fitted with a single screw that is used to secure the handle to the frame of the window and aren't as secure as other kinds of window handles.

Tilt and Turn Handles

As opposed to the other upvc handles, tilt and turn handles can both be rotated to open the window and tilted inwards for ventilation. They feature a 7mm spindle in the back and are available in right-hand and left-hand versions.

It is essential to know the spindle's size prior to purchasing a replacement window handle handles made of upvc. Not all of them are the exact same size. To test the length of your upvc handle simply drop something into the middle of the hole and measure how far it extends before it comes into contact with an obstruction. This is the maximum size of spindle that will fit in your windows.

What is the spindle?

uPVC window replacement handles function in a similar way to doors. By turning the handle, you can activate a latch inside the frame. The window is then opened and shut. The handles can become damaged, especially if they're often used or are exposed to harsh conditions. This can lead to the need to replace your uPVC windows handles as they might not be able to operate the window in a proper manner for a long time.

There are many types of uPVC handles, including Espag, Cockspur, and Spaded handles. They are designed to fit into the uPVC frames in different ways. Each handle uses a specific spindle to lock the mechanism fitted to the window. It is essential to determine the type of handle installed on your uPVC windows so that you can replace it with the right one.

The base of the handle will inform you what kind of uPVC it is. There should be a "snap-in' cover over one screw that holds the handle's base in the correct position. When you remove this cover and you'll be able to see the second screw that holds the handle base in position. After both screws are removed you should be able to pull the handle away from the uPVC window.

After taking off the uPVC handle, carefully remove it from the locking mechanism. Make note of the length of the spindle, as you'll need to make sure that you purchase one that is the same length as the original handle and locking mechanism.

The most common issue with uPVC window handle problems is that the spindle becomes worn out and can no longer operate the locking mechanism. This could be due to corrosion, damage from constant use or the locking mechanism becoming looser. If this happens, you will need to replace both the window replacement cost handle and locking mechanism to restore the full functionality of your uPVC Windows.

How do I remove the handle that was previously attached?

Window handles can be damaged or even broken over the course of time. It is crucial to repair them as quickly as possible to ensure your security. The good news is that replacing a damaged or worn handle is a simple task that can be completed in less than an hour and doesn't require any specialized tools.

To remove the handle, first remove the screw located at the base of the handle. Once the screw is removed, the handle will be pulled away. There will be another screw located at the bottom of the handle's base, and this can be removed as well. After these two screws have been removed, the handle can be detached from the window's base.

After the handle has been removed, grab the new handle and align the fixing holes with the holes currently in the window frame. If there is a cap or sticker on the new handle, remove it if required and put the handle back in the appropriate position. Once the handle is in place it is essential to check that it works by turning the handle, and ensuring that the lock mechanism activates.

Espag handles come with spindles that extend out of the handle and slots into the multipoint locking mechanism of the window frame. Cadenza windows feature an edge with cut-outs which slot into the lock mechanism while Cockspur handles have a long nose that hooks over the frame's outer or transom bar cross-member inside the window.

After you have installed the new handle, place the spindle into the window lock and tighten it. Replace the snap-in cover and screw cap (if necessary) after the handle is securely fixed. Once the handle is in use, simply open and close the window a few times to ensure it works properly and securely.

How do I fit the new handle?

It's not difficult to change the handle on your windows made of uPVC. The process is very easy. All you need is a screwdriver and small amount of patience. First, make sure the handle is not locked. Then, remove any visible screws. You can also replace them using screw caps. After removing the handle, you'll need to take note of the length of spindle that extends from the back. This is important as it will determine the type of handle that you will need to purchase.

Espagnolette handles made of uPVC are the most popular type of handle. The spindle runs through the handle to control the locking mechanism in the frame of the window. Once the handle is turned it releases the latch on the window, allowing it to open. In regular use and time, handles for espagnolette may be damaged.

Cadenza handles are a different kind of uPVC window handle, which is typically used on tilt and turn windows. They feature a protruding blade that works with a multiple-point locking mechanism within the window. They are generally more secure than espagnolette handles as they are only accessible from the inside. They can be replaced with the same method as espagnolette handles however you must make sure that the new handle has a curved blade instead of flat ones.

Once you have determined the right handle for you then you can align the new handle with the screw holes, and then screw it in place. After that, you should put the screw covers back on and make sure your new handle is operating correctly. You can do this by moving the handle between the locked position to the unlocked one a few time. It might be worthwhile to speak with an expert to see if you can resolve any issues.
